浏览模式: 标准 | 列表 2017年05月25日的文章

IIS6获取用户的真实IP

手头有一台云主机,但是该云主机还有一个“前端”,当通过web访问该云主机上的网站时,日志中留下的只是前端的IP而不是客户端真实IP,经过检索,可用插件F5XForwardedFor.dll解决这个问题:

来源:https://help.aliyun.com/knowledge_detail/37948.html

IIS 6日志中获取访客真实IP的解决方案——安装插件F5XForwardedFor.dll

1、下载与安装:http://aliyuntool.oss.aliyuncs.com/F5XForwardedFor2008.zip。

2、根据自己的版本将x86\Release 或者x64\Release目录下的F5XForwardedFor.dll拷贝到某个目录,假设为C:\ISAPIFilters,确保对IIS进程对该目录有读取权限。

3、打开IIS管理器,找到当前开启的网站,在该网站上右键选择“属性”,打开属性页。

4、属性页切换至“ISAPI筛选器”,点击“添加”按钮,出现添加窗口。

5、在添加窗口:“筛选器名称”填写“F5XForwardedFor”,“可执行文件”填写F5XForwardedFor.dll的完整路径。

6、点击确定,然后重启IIS服务器。